Output dd6c360969549f2a266f6cadf1869cdea894f5f84235265f6a161ca07110bc35:0

value
6947008181100
script pubkey
OP_0 OP_PUSHBYTES_20 c872aa3c7474586eb1b8e54ac120410609cd0942
address
tb1qepe250r5w3vxavdcu49vzgzpqcyu6z2z54x8wd
transaction
dd6c360969549f2a266f6cadf1869cdea894f5f84235265f6a161ca07110bc35
confirmations
189696
spent
true